Synchronization
AUSS performs synchronization in one direction only: from Source System to MarkView. Do not maintain users in MarkView that you manage with AUSS. Manual changes in MarkView might be overwritten the next time you synchronize users.
If the synchronization is running, the Synchronization window displays manual synchronization status, including the time when the process was started, the user who started it, the synchronization duration, options, and processed users count. The window also displays the last lines of a log file as they appear in a real-time mode. The Synchronize one user and Synchronize buttons are disabled during the synchronization. If the synchronization is not running, you may start the synchronization for a selected user or for all users with the required options.
